Output fb04b17f38acbfbcc24ae978812741f06926a6aff0763855bf16783bed95ffba:42

value
516456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df148cd2c7d77b32cd691849ae9cdea81b266ce4 OP_EQUAL
address
3N2ZEAf5oCbe1WYAcRip4P5Z86yxJbJ45C
transaction
fb04b17f38acbfbcc24ae978812741f06926a6aff0763855bf16783bed95ffba
spent
true